Transaction 58a8d346973167fcc2cc34541557b1e0b042887b3a6d171219976ed1de14bccc
1 Input
1 Output
-
58a8d346973167fcc2cc34541557b1e0b042887b3a6d171219976ed1de14bccc:0
- value
- 1000593670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fee2986b644bf4c7633ca8978b6a8e69f2a979d3 OP_EQUAL
- address
- 3Qvj1PhwjAy6DZZCHPWC4fY1ET4bq55ZtC